Job description

GENERAL PURPOSE OF THE JOB:

The Automation Engineer leads end-to-end project delivery, including requirements gathering, system architecture, prototyping, production deployment, and ongoing iteration.


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:


  • Design and build company-owned internal software, data pipelines, and integrations to replace Excel as an operational backbone

  • Translate ambiguous business needs into clear functional and technical specifications

  • Select appropriate tools, technologies, and architectures to deliver scalable and maintainable solutions

  • Develop robust, efficient, and reliable systems, ensuring accuracy and correctness through validation and testing

  • Drive execution and delivery, shipping improvements quickly and iterating based on feedback and results

  • Replace manual workflows with production software

  • Translate informal processes into clear data models, services, and user-facing tools.

  • Build internal web apps, APIs, and automation services that users adopt.

  • Ingest data from files, forms, SaaS tools, and internal databases.

  • Implement ETL/ELT pipelines with validation, lineage, and monitoring.

  • Integrate systems via REST APIs, webhooks, queues, and scheduled jobs.

  • Design relational schemas, enforce constraints, manage migrations.

  • Build \"single source of truth\" datasets for analytics + operations.

  • Operationalize ML

  • Use pre-trained models (LLMs / vision / classical ML) for classification, extraction, routing, forecasting, etc.

  • When needed: fine-tune/train on company data, evaluate properly, deploy with monitoring.


EDUCATION:

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Data Science, AI/ML


EXPERIENCE:


  • Proficiency in at least one backend language: e.g.Python, TypeScript/Node.js, or C#/.NET

  • Ability to build automation/services that handle data, integrate APIs, and run reliably in production.

  • Strong SQL and relational fundamentals (schema design basics, joins/aggregations, constraints, query debugging; Postgres/MySQL/SQL Server).

  • Ability to build and consume REST APIs (HTTP basics, auth patterns, pagination, error handling).

  • Solid software engineering fundamentals: data structures + OOP, readable, maintainable code, debugging and refactoring.

  • Git workflow experience (branches, pull requests, code review habits).

  • Clear technical communication: can write clean documentation


OTHER SKILLS AND ABILITIES:


  • Framework experience: FastAPI / Flask / Django, ASP.NET Core, NestJS / Express

  • Data pipeline orchestration tooling: Airflow / Dagster / Prefect

  • Docker experience and basic CI/CD (GitHub Actions, Azure DevOps, or similar)

  • Cloud exposure (AWS / Azure / GCP): managed databases, object storage, message queues

  • Building SaaS integrations using REST APIs / webhooks
